Método SqlCeRemoteDataAccess.Pull (String, String, String, RdaTrackOption, String)
Esse tipo tem um atributo SecurityCriticalAttribute, que o restringe a uso interno pela biblioteca de classes do .NET Framework for Silverlight. O código do aplicativo que usa qualquer membro desse tipo gera um MethodAccessException.
[SEGURANÇA CRÍTICA]
Baixa dados de um banco de dados do SQL Server remoto e os armazena em uma única tabela em um banco de dados do SQL Server Compact local.
Namespace: System.Data.SqlServerCe
Assembly: System.Data.SqlServerCe (em System.Data.SqlServerCe.dll)
Sintaxe
'Declaração
Public Sub Pull ( _
localTableName As String, _
sqlSelectString As String, _
oleDBConnectionString As String, _
trackOption As RdaTrackOption, _
errorTable As String _
)
'Uso
Dim instance As SqlCeRemoteDataAccess
Dim localTableName As String
Dim sqlSelectString As String
Dim oleDBConnectionString As String
Dim trackOption As RdaTrackOption
Dim errorTable As String
instance.Pull(localTableName, sqlSelectString, _
oleDBConnectionString, trackOption, _
errorTable)
public void Pull(
string localTableName,
string sqlSelectString,
string oleDBConnectionString,
RdaTrackOption trackOption,
string errorTable
)
public:
void Pull(
String^ localTableName,
String^ sqlSelectString,
String^ oleDBConnectionString,
RdaTrackOption trackOption,
String^ errorTable
)
member Pull :
localTableName:string *
sqlSelectString:string *
oleDBConnectionString:string *
trackOption:RdaTrackOption *
errorTable:string -> unit
public function Pull(
localTableName : String,
sqlSelectString : String,
oleDBConnectionString : String,
trackOption : RdaTrackOption,
errorTable : String
)
Parâmetros
- localTableName
Tipo: System.String
O nome da tabela do SQL Server Compact que receberá os registros extraídos do SQL Server. Se a tabela já existir, ocorrerá um erro.
- sqlSelectString
Tipo: System.String
Qualquer instrução Transact-SQL válida, incluindo instruções SELECT e procedimentos armazenados, que especifica que tabela, colunas e registros devem ser extraídos do banco de dados do SQL Server para armazenamento no banco de dados do SQL Server Compact.
- oleDBConnectionString
Tipo: System.String
- trackOption
Tipo: System.Data.SqlServerCe.RdaTrackOption
A opção que indica se o SQL Server Compact controla as alterações da tabela puxada e se os índices que existem na tabela que está sendo puxada são trazidos para o dispositivo com as restrições PRIMARY KEY.
- errorTable
Tipo: System.String
O nome da tabela de erros local que será criada se ocorrer um erro quando o método Push for chamado posteriormente para enviar as alterações de volta ao SQL Server. Esta opção poderá ser especificada somente quando o valor de RdaTrackOption for TrackingOn ou TrackingOnWithIndexes.